We're writing in English. 

Once upon a time, in the Mushroom Kingdom, there lived a princess named Peach. Peach was a friendly, nice young woman, who had loads of friends. One of her friends, Daisy, was princess of the kingdom of Sarasaland. Though they lived far apart, they were best friends and they visited each other very often. 
Princess Peach was currently planning a big event to maintain the friendship between the other royals and her. To help organising this huge party, she wanted the help of no one else but Daisy. Of course, there she was, happy to travel to the Mushroom kingdom to help out her best friend. Everything was going perfectly fine, until the party itself started.

 

This is where we will start this story.
